Abstract:
The social network site (SNS) “BeReal” recently increased in popularity. In contrast to conventional SNS, BeReal counteracts staged self-portrayal and employing filters. Instead, it aims to uncover how users actually are by posting a photo at an unannounced time within a short period. Therefore, other, BeReal-specific factors need to be taken into account to entirely understand why people are (not) using this app. Building on the Self-Determination Theory, components of the Unified Theory of Acceptance, Use of Technology 2, and BeReal-specific particularities, a research model is validated by n=657 consumers using partial least square structural equation modeling. The authors appear to be the first to shed light on consumers’ usage intentions of this special type of SNS.
